摘要
本文给出了一种从多角度2D条形图重建三维曲面模型的方法。该方法从不同侧面曲面物体的2D条形图出发,经过条形线段匹配,三维空间坐标计算,获得三维条形图,再经过一维插值,重建出三维曲面模型。该方法已在PIII 800的PC机上进行了验证,成功的重建了一人头石膏像的3D表面模型。
A method for reconstructing a 3D surface model from several 2D strip profiles is proposed. The process starts from several 2D strip profiles, and then four steps are needed for matching lines, calculating 3D coordinator, forming 3D strips, interpolating at 1D, at last the 3D surface model was reconstructed. As an experiment example, a 3D surface model of a plaster model have been successfully reconstructed on a platform of PIII 800 personal computer.
